Perplexity

What Perplexity does

Perplexity is an AI-native “answer engine” that combines conversational search with source grounding (inline citations and links). Users ask questions and receive synthesized answers that are backed by verifiable references, aiming to reduce the work of clicking through multiple pages to confirm facts.

Product-wise, Perplexity presents itself as more than a single chatbot: it offers (1) an Answer Engine experience for consumers and teams, (2) workflow-oriented agentic tooling under “Computer” and related products for research, analysis, and task execution, and (3) an API/agent platform so developers can embed grounded AI search and research into their own products.

For enterprise customers, Perplexity positions “Perplexity Enterprise” as an internal-knowledge + external-research system, with integrations to surface answers from enterprise files and applications, while also supporting web research with citations. The enterprise page also emphasizes security controls (for example, SOC 2 Type II certification) and claims about not training on customer enterprise data.

Perplexity’s strategic position is that it is scaling from consumer search/answers into agentic “work completion” and developer/enterprise distribution—expanding where its AI can be embedded (for example, bringing “Computer” into Microsoft 365/Teams via Personal Computer for Windows).

Jan 04, 2024 · Official · Perplexity BlogPerplexity raises Series B funding round

Perplexity announced a Series B funding round of $73.6M led by IVP, citing continued support from prior investors and listing additional new investors; the post also included product/traction context (e.g., monthly active users and query volumes).

Date not disclosed · Official · Perplexity BlogPerplexity raises Series A funding round

Perplexity announced a $25.6M Series A round led by Peter Sonsini (NEA), listing participation from seed investors and new investors; the post also discussed an iPhone app launch and growth metrics it reported at the time.
